Small-Scale Solar Power Systems: A Cost-Effective Solution for Sustainable Energy
Small-scale solar power systems are becoming an increasingly popular choice for homeowners and businesses looking to reduce their carbon footprint and energy costs. These systems, which typically range from a few hundred watts to several kilowatts, can provide a significant portion of a building's energy needs. They work by converting sunlight into electricity using photovoltaic (PV) panels, which can then be used to power appliances, lighting, and other electrical systems.One of the main advantages of small-scale solar power systems is their cost-effectiveness. With government incentives and the decreasing cost of PV panels, installing a solar system can save you money in the long run. Additionally, these systems require little maintenance and can last for decades, providing a reliable source of renewable energy for many years.Another benefit is that small-scale solar power systems can help to reduce your reliance on the grid. During the day, when the sun is shining, your solar panels will likely produce more energy than you need, which can be stored in batteries or fed back into the grid through a process called net metering. This can result in lower utility bills and a more stable energy supply, especially during power outages.Moreover, small-scale solar power systems contribute to a cleaner environment by reducing greenhouse gas emissions. Solar energy is a renewable resource that does not produce harmful pollutants, making it an eco-friendly choice for those concerned about climate change.In conclusion, small-scale solar power systems offer a practical and affordable way to transition to sustainable energy. Whether you're a homeowner looking to power your home or a business aiming to reduce operational costs, solar energy is a smart investment for the future.

At the heart of this revolution lies the principle of solar energy conversion - harnessing the sun's rays to produce electricity. The process is simple yet effective, as light beams are intercepted by specialized cells that are coated with thin layers of semiconductor material. When these cells absorb light, they create an electron-hole pair, which then flows through an electrical circuit and generates electricity. This process is known as photovoltaic conversion or PV conversion.
Small photovoltaic power systems are designed to fit seamlessly into any environment, whether it be a residential rooftop or a commercial property. They come in various sizes, shapes, and styles, each tailored to meet specific needs and preferences. For instance, some models are designed for easy installation on sloped rooftops, while others are engineered for durability and longevity in harsh weather conditions.
